dhcp: Default to using local DNS resolution
It's pointless to not include default DNS resolution for Neutron.
This adds a new config option (dnsmasq_local_resolv) which defaults
to 'True' and will allow for DNS name resolution to work out of
the box. The caveat is that if the 'dnsmasq_dns_servers' is set it
will override the 'dnsmasq_local_resolv' setting, thus allowing
operators to explicitly set their own DNS servers.
DocImpact: Default to using local DNS resolution with the DHCP agent.
